Future Contract Considerations for SmartTrack and Other Capital Project Agreements

The decision
2026-05-01 · Audit Committee · adopted
As filed
The Audit Committee: 1. Received the report (April 17, 2026) from the Chief Procurement Officer and the Director, Internal Audit, for information.

The purpose of this report is to assess the adequacy of the City's contract management and project management processes with respect to the SmartTrack Project and whether they ensure value for money and project delivery timelines. The report also identifies requirements that should be considered in future contracts and projects to protect the interests of the City, including the addition of audit clauses. This is in response to the motions made at the February 2026 Audit Committee meeting and the March 2026 City Council meeting.
Staff recommended
The Chief Procurement Officer and the Director, Internal Audit recommend that: 1. The Audit Committee receive this report for information.
